The Residential Water Extraction Process: What to Expect

When you call us for Residential Water Extraction in Roanoke, TX, you can expect a thorough and efficient process. Our team will assess the damage, extract the water, and dry the area to prevent mold and further damage.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our technicians will evaluate the extent of the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ry the area. This step typically takes 30 minutes to 1 hour.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using our advanced equipment, we’ll ext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This step typ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the size of the area.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use specialized equipment to dry the area and remove any remaining moisture. This step typically takes 2-3 days, depending on the severity of the damage.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Our technicians will cl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ent mold and bacteria growth. This step typically takes 1-2 days.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Report

We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is dry and free of damage. We’ll also provide a detailed report to your insurance company, if applicable.

Warning Signs You Need Residential Water Extraction

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s. Here are some war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show mold growth. If you notice a musty smell in your home, it’s time to call us.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Water damage can cause your flooring to warp or buckle.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s essential to act quickly.

Water Stains on Walls or Ceilings

Water stains can be a sign of a larger issue. If you notice any water stains, it’s time to call us for a thorough inspection.

Discoloration or Warping of Baseboards

Water damage can cause your baseboards to discolor or warp. If you notice any changes in your baseboards, it’s time to act.

Residential Water Extraction Cost in Roanoke, TX

The cost of Residential Water Extraction in Roanoke, TX can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Here are some estimated price ranges for different services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ction (small area) $500 – $1,500 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ment needed
Water Extraction (large area) $2,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ment needed
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and duration of service
Cleaning and Sanitizing $500 – $1,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and level of contamination
Final Inspection and Report $200 – $500 Size of affected area and complexity of the job

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ates and flexible payment plans to fit your budget.
